Can't click inside posts/pages box with 3.4
-
When I try to write a post or change a page the cursor simply will not click inside the box and there is no content to be seen even when I copy/paste it in….
I am using the Woo theme Optimize with version 3.4. A couple days ago Woo themes support updated the framework I was using and I think that potentially I updated the WP version to 3.4 around the same time. Since this point, the boxes have been broken.
First I went to Woo themes to sort this out as thought it was their framework but their support guys didn’t find anything.
They ran a few standard debugging issues, but not found anything as the culprit. They switched and deleted themes, de-activated plugins, etc… They said “There is something funky going on with WordPress itself and I’m not sure where it’s coming from.
I even ran your site through a security scan and it didn’t find any issues there.”I then had to post in the Woo themes forum to get help from other more skilled devs.
The next Woo support guy thought it may be a JavaScript issue and replied:
“It seems that the main jQuery file bundled with WordPress is either not present or not being loaded correctly.
Did this happen, perchance, after upgrading to WordPress 3.4? If so, I’d recommend doing a reinstall via the “Dashboard > Updates” screen (backup everything before you do) and, if that doesn’t resolve the issue, re-uploading the “wp-includes” folder of your WordPress installation via FTP would ensure that the file is present. :)”So, I reuploaded the wp-includes folder – no change
Then I reuploaded the wp-admin folder too – no change
(at this point all plugins are still deactivated)He then came back with:
“I’ve spent some time in your installation and via FTP and, during testing, disabled all admin-side JavaScript in the WooFramework, to no avail.
It seems the error is coming from within WordPress itself.
If you setup a fresh installation somewhere else (either on your computer or on a different web space somewhere), with the version of Optimize you have running currently, does the error persist? In addition, does switching to the TwentyEleven theme briefly resolve the issue? (this would indicate if the issue is theme-related).”I then did this the following;
1) Install the version of Optimize I happen to have on my computer which is version 1.1. (NOT 2.3.6 as I currently had on the broken site) onto the 2nd test site.
2) Check I can post – ALL OK.
3) Upgrade WP to version 3.4. and check I can post again – ALL OK
4) Switch theme to TwentyEleven and check I can still edit the post – ALL OK
5) Download current version of Optimize I have and upload to new site (Optimize 2.3.6 Framework 5.3.12) and check I can post again – ALL OK
(NB at this point there was also a message saying an old version of “TimThumb” was found and to update which I did but then got an error message saying not enough permissions to do but I guess this is a separate issue!!)
The “optimize custom settings” under the post box comes up in a nicer format than it had done on broken site where only half appeared.
So – Optimize and version 3.4 work ok on the 2nd test site but still not on the broken current site.Because it all worked on the 2nd site I used that version of Optimize to re-upload to the broken site (and renaming the version there to something else temporarily) – this didn’t work either so I reuploaded the former version back.
